The MCF52254CAF66 belongs to the category of microcontrollers.
This microcontroller is commonly used in various electronic devices and embedded systems.
The MCF52254CAF66 is available in a compact and durable package, suitable for surface mount technology (SMT) assembly.
The essence of the MCF52254CAF66 lies in its ability to provide efficient processing power and versatile features for a wide range of applications.
The microcontroller is typically packaged in reels or trays, with quantities varying based on customer requirements.
The MCF52254CAF66 has a total of 144 pins, which are assigned to various functions such as general-purpose input/output (GPIO), communication interfaces, timers, and other peripherals. A detailed pin configuration diagram can be found in the product datasheet.
The MCF52254CAF66 operates based on the ColdFire V2 core architecture, which utilizes a 32-bit RISC (Reduced Instruction Set Computing) design. It executes instructions at high clock speeds, enabling efficient processing of complex tasks. The microcontroller interacts with various peripherals and external devices through its communication interfaces and GPIO pins.
The MCF52254CAF66 finds applications in diverse fields, including but not limited to: - Industrial automation - Consumer electronics - Automotive systems - Medical devices - Internet of Things (IoT) applications

Q: What is the MCF52254CAF66 microcontroller used for? A: The MCF52254CAF66 is a microcontroller commonly used in embedded systems for various applications, including industrial control, consumer electronics, and automotive systems.
Q: What is the maximum clock frequency supported by the MCF52254CAF66? A: The MCF52254CAF66 supports a maximum clock frequency of 66 MHz.
Q: How much flash memory does the MCF52254CAF66 have? A: The MCF52254CAF66 has 256 KB of flash memory for program storage.
Q: Can I expand the memory of the MCF52254CAF66? A: Yes, the MCF52254CAF66 supports external memory expansion through its memory bus interface.
Q: What communication interfaces are available on the MCF52254CAF66? A: The MCF52254CAF66 features several communication interfaces, including UART, SPI, I2C, and Ethernet.
Q: Does the MCF52254CAF66 support analog-to-digital conversion? A: Yes, the MCF52254CAF66 has an integrated 12-bit ADC module for analog-to-digital conversion.
Q: Can I use the MCF52254CAF66 for real-time applications? A: Yes, the MCF52254CAF66 has built-in timers and interrupt capabilities that make it suitable for real-time applications.
Q: What operating voltage range does the MCF52254CAF66 support? A: The MCF52254CAF66 operates at a voltage range of 2.7V to 3.6V.
Q: Is the MCF52254CAF66 compatible with other microcontrollers or development tools? A: The MCF52254CAF66 is part of the ColdFire family of microcontrollers and is compatible with various development tools and software libraries.
Q: Can I program the MCF52254CAF66 using a high-level language like C? A: Yes, the MCF52254CAF66 can be programmed using high-level languages like C or C++, making it easier for developers to write code for their applications.
